Devotional: Leviticus 5:14-6:7

Today’s passage: Leviticus 5:14-6:7

Helpful thoughts:

  • In these verses, we read about guilt offerings.
  • Guilt offerings seem to be quite similar to sin offerings, except:
    • The animals sacrificed were males, not females (More costly).
    • Payment was to be made.  A restoration of what was lost, plus 20%.
      • These differences seem to indicate the offenses which necessitated a guilt offering were more severe and costly to others than that which necessitated a sin offering.
  • True repentance includes a turning from our sin to righteousness.  A person who is truly repentant will want to make things right with the one he/she has sinned against (2 Corinthians 7:10-11).
